The effects of Brassica green manures on plant parasitic and free living nematodes used in combination with reduced rates of synthetic nematicides
Brassica plants once incorporated into soil as green manures have recently been shown to have biofumigant properties and have the potential of controlling plant-parasitic nematodes.
